Mercury stations retrograde on September 9 and remains in backward motion until it stations direct on October 2, when retrograde ends. When Mercury—the planet that governs communication, the sharing and receiving of data and information, as well as local travel—slows down to a stop and pivots to move backward on September 9, it’s our sign to slow down and pivot as well.
